Thin Black Line
The lie between the line which fades
To bring a life, to save a life back from the brink of day.
For those who share and those who save,
The final word is all but theirs -
The binding clock which turns the tide
Will bring hope to lavished pride.
In turn to which will surely stand
To help and heal a witch's hand.
But those who seek are all but true
As it brings trouble through,
Dark and light, dawn and dusk.
As lines which blur turn to dust
As those who lie will quickly find -
The lie which lies between the thin black line.
